REFX

REFX
Syntax
REFX <numeric>[OHM|SIE]
REFX?
Description
Sets the X-axis reference value (center value) in the complex plane format.
Parameters
If the specified parameter is out of the allowable setting range, the minimum value (if the
lower limit of the range is not reached) or the maximum value (if the upper limit of the
range is exceeded) is set.
Query response
{numeric}<newline><^END>
Corresponding
[Scale Ref]
key

REFY

Syntax
REFY <numeric>[OHM|SIE]
REFY?
Description
Sets the Y-axis reference value (center value) in the complex plane format.
Parameters
If the specified parameter is out of the allowable setting range, the minimum value (if the
lower limit of the range is not reached) or the maximum value (if the upper limit of the
range is exceeded) is set.
Query response
{numeric}<newline><^END>
Corresponding
[Scale Ref]
key
